VAST: Autism and Apraxia - CAS (Paid)
by: iTherapy
Subject Communication, POHI/CI Accessibility Feature Magnification Platform iOS Age Range Elementary, Preschool, Secondary VAST provides video-assisted speech therapy. This app provides therapy to students with autism and motor-speech programming disorders such as apraxia. VAST combines the concept of video modeling with written words and auditory cues to help individuals acquire relevant words, phrases, and sentences so they can speak for themselves. For children and individuals with strong visual skills, this can be a key to developing speech.

vBookz Audiobooks (Paid)
by: MindEx International Ltd
Subject Community of Practice, ILS, Leisure/Recreation, Reading, Utility Accessibility Feature Magnification, Text to Speech, VoiceOver/Screen Reader Platform iOS Age Range Secondary, Teachers vBookz Audiobooks offers advanced, high-quality text-to-speech reading in 17 languages. It's the best way to follow and read documents on iPad, iPhone, or iPod. vBookz Audiobooks also includes orientation and navigation tools that enhance the reading experience. It reads out loud from more than 40,000 classic books and uses the leading live text-to-speech generator with no need for conversion or stored audio files. vBookz Audiobooks has an all-in-one support and reads PDF non-DRM e-books. It is integrated with Dropbox, Google Drive, and Gutenberg.

Visor (Free)
by: Nverba
Subject Community of Practice, ILS, Leisure/Recreation, Utility Accessibility Feature Magnification, VoiceOver/Screen Reader Platform Browser/Software Extension Age Range Elementary, Preschool, Secondary This screen dimmer and reading aid may help with fluency, eye strain, concentration, and comprehension while reading. Visor's overlays and point of focus feature may assist users with visual perceptual difficulties such as dyslexia, scotopic sensitivity syndrome, and visual stress.
